Understanding the Relationship Between iPhone and Apple Watch

The Apple Watch is designed to work seamlessly with your iPhone. When you install an app on your iPhone, it often syncs with your Apple Watch, allowing you to access the features directly on your wrist. However, the relationship between the two devices can lead to confusion about how app management works.

Do Apps on iPhone Affect Apple Watch?

When you delete an app from your iPhone, it generally affects the Apple Watch in the following ways:

  • Directly Linked Apps: If an app is directly linked to your Apple Watch, deleting it from your iPhone will also remove it from your watch.
  • Standalone Apps: Some apps may exist independently on your Apple Watch. In these cases, you can delete the app from your iPhone without affecting the one on your watch.
  • Syncing Issues: Occasionally, syncing issues can arise where the app may not uninstall properly from the watch, leading to residual data.

Understanding this relationship can help you make informed decisions about which apps to keep or remove.

Step-by-Step Process to Delete Apps on iPhone and Apple Watch

If you decide to streamline your app collection, here’s a step-by-step guide on how to delete apps from your iPhone and manage them on your Apple Watch.

Deleting Apps from iPhone

  1. Locate the App: Find the app you want to delete on your iPhone’s home screen.
  2. Press and Hold: Tap and hold the app icon until a menu appears.
  3. Select Delete App: From the menu, select “Remove App,” then choose “Delete App” to confirm.
  4. Confirm Deletion: Tap “Delete” to remove the app from your iPhone.

Deleting Apps from Apple Watch

  1. Open the Watch App: On your iPhone, open the Apple Watch app.
  2. Select My Watch: Tap on the “My Watch” tab at the bottom.
  3. Find the App: Scroll down to find the app you wish to delete.
  4. Toggle Off: Tap on the app and toggle off “Show App on Apple Watch.”
  5. Confirm Removal: The app will be removed from your Apple Watch.

Common Misconceptions About Deleting Apps

Many users have misconceptions about deleting apps from their devices. Here are some common myths debunked:

  • Myth 1: Deleting an app will delete all associated data.
    Truth: Some apps store data in the cloud, which remains accessible even after the app is deleted.
  • Myth 2: You cannot reinstall deleted apps.
    Truth: Deleted apps can be easily re-downloaded from the App Store.
  • Myth 3: Deleting apps can significantly improve device performance.
    Truth: While deleting unused apps can free up storage space, performance is more dependent on other factors such as background processes.

Troubleshooting Tips for App Management on Apple Watch

Sometimes, users may encounter issues after deleting apps. Here are some troubleshooting tips for managing your Apple Watch and iPhone:

  • Check for Updates: Ensure that both your iPhone and Apple Watch are running the latest software. Updates often include bug fixes that can resolve syncing issues.
  • Restart Devices: Restart your iPhone and Apple Watch to refresh the connection between the two.
  • Unpair and Re-pair: If problems persist, try unpairing your Apple Watch from your iPhone and then pairing them again. This can help clear any residual app data.
  • Contact Support: If you continue to experience issues, consider reaching out to Apple Support for personalized assistance.
